KarlvN Posted April 17, 2016 Share Only allowed if you're a member of the club with a valid 2016 member board clearly displayed on your handle bars. Your board MUST be visible AT ALL TIMES, no exceptions allowed. Any person riding the corridor without a board is riding rogue, and puts the club at risk of losing that trail corridor, perhaps even the entire trail linked to that farm. Land access permissions are highly sensitive with the landowners, partly due to arrogant behavior of prior rogue riders towards landowners and various stakeholders when confronted.
